**Ticket #—: Reindex vault locked again**

Hey folks — the nightly search reindex on Pellgrove failed at 02:10 because the credentials vault auto-locked mid-run and the job couldn't fetch the indexer token. This is the third time this month, so until the auto-lock timer is fixed, support can unlock it manually and rerun the reindex from the scheduler page. Don't bother paging the platform team for this one. To unlock the vault, use the recovery passphrase noted just below.

vault phrase of tajef-tafog = istox-sorax-zorox-casok-holox-kelix-weneth-drueth-casion

Ticket: Staging env misconfigured for Siftgate bloom filter

The bloom layer in front of the Pellet KV store is rejecting all lookups in staging because the env file was copied from the dev template without credentials. False-positive tuning values are fine; only the auth line is missing. To unblock the weekly demo, the Pellet admission secret must be set on the following line.

env line for yaguf-fajop: LEDGER_TOKEN13=fb08984397349

Hey on-call friend — this is the fiddly part of migrating Shrinkly's batch CLI. The old `shrinkly batch` command read flags straight from the shell; the new one pulls everything from a config file, so your cron jobs need updating before Tuesday's cutover. Run the dry-run mode first and compare output dimensions against a sample set — mismatches usually mean a stale quality preset. Once the dry run looks clean, drop the config below into place and restart the worker. Here's the full set of values we're shipping with.

deployment values, yadup-kadug:
[sorys]
port = 5672
team = noveth
host = sorys.orvexcorp.example
region = south-4
access_code = ac_deddc1
timeout_ms = 1500

## Handover — Admin Dashboard Dark Mode

Dark-mode theming for the Larchgate admin dashboard is done except contrast checks on the audit-log view. Theme tokens live in `ui/palette`; no inline colors remain. No auth or session code was touched, but the CSS pipeline changed, so please re-scan. Security review questions should go to the engineer named below.

account owner for bawip-tahag: Raleth Quenok